HANDBRAKE POWER STEERING
To release:
Pull the lever up slightly, press
button 1 and then lower the lever to
the floor.
The red warning light on the
instrument panel will light up if
you are driving with an incorrectly
released handbrake.
Make sure that the
handbrake is properly
released when driving,
otherwise overheating
may occur.
To apply
Pull upwards, ensure that the
vehicle cannot move.
Depending on the slope
and/or vehicle load, it
may be necessary to pull
up the handbrake at least
two extra notches and engage a
gear (1st or reverse gear) for
vehicles with manual gearboxes
or position P for vehicles with
automatic gearboxes.

Variable power assisted
steering
The variable power assisted steering
system is equipped with an
electronic control system which
alters the level of assistance to suit
the vehicle speed.
The steering is lighter for parking
manoeuvres and becomes heavier
as the speed increases.
Operating faults
If the warning light flashes
whentheengineisstarted,turnthe
steering wheel slowly from lock to
lock to reset the system.
Never switch off the
ignition when travelling
downhill, and avoid
doing so in normal
driving (power steering and
brake servo will not function).
